[jira] [Updated] (OOZIE-1186) Image load for Job DAG visualization should handle resources better

WIP patch to free up memory resources used during image generation, and i/o resources in servlet.

Conducted memory profiling of Oozie server JVM run with and without the patch and saw the difference.
Need to think about unit tests for the same.

> The Job DAG visualization loads an image into memory to be streamed on outputstream. However, it does not free up memory and I/O resources leading to 'Out of Java heap space' errors.
